A "Hope Tree" is now on display for the holidays at "BODIES... The Exhibition" located inside the Luxor Hotel and Casino.

A spokesperson says the tree is meant to encourage guests to share messages of inspiration during what could be a difficult time for those experiencing loneliness or sadness.

Guests can donate $1 to receive a wooden ornament to write an encouraging message on and hang on the tree. Other visitors can read all of the messages.

Proceeds from the ornaments will go toward national suicide prevention charities.

"BODIES... The Exhibition" is open daily from 11 a.m. to 8 p.m. It showcases more than 275 real human bodies and specimens, along with information on mental health, fitness and nutrition, to serve as an educational attraction.
